Why "add 2 mL" is not an instruction: the powder in the vial takes up space. "Add 2 mL to a 10 mL vial" and "add 2 mL of diluent so the final volume is approximately 2 mL" are different instructions. Stating the final target volume is clearer than stating the diluent added.
Choosing a concentration on purpose rather than by accident: starting with "I want to draw 0.5 mL per dose" and working backward to the required concentration is more efficient than picking a diluent volume and hoping the math works out. State your target volume, then the required concentration follows.

Osmolarity and reconstitution: the osmolarity of the reconstituted solution affects comfort on injection. Isotonic solutions (close to blood osmolarity) are less irritating than hypertonic solutions. This is why diluent choice (sterile water vs. saline) matters.
Over-dilution: if your target dose is 0.25 mg and your syringe is a 1 mL insulin syringe, you need a concentration high enough that 0.25 mg fits on the scale. A 0.25 mg/mL solution requires drawing the entire 1 mL syringe — not readable. A 5 mg/mL solution requires drawing 50 μL — also not practical on an insulin syringe.
